Materials and Build Quality
The Glass Teapot with Removable Infuser is crafted from Borosilicate Glass, known for its lightweight and durable properties. This material can withstand extreme temperatures, ranging from -20℃ to 150℃, ensuring versatility in use. In contrast, the Tea Kettle by Tohsssik is constructed from 18/8 Culinary Grade Stainless Steel, which is rust and corrosion-resistant. While both materials are safe for food use, the glass teapot offers a unique aesthetic experience, allowing users to see the blooming tea flowers, while the stainless steel kettle emphasizes durability and longevity.

Functionality and Ease of Use
Functionally, the Glass Teapot with Removable Infuser excels in its ability to brew various types of tea, including loose-leaf, flowering tea, and even coffee. The removable infuser allows for easy cleaning and convenience. The teapot's non-dripping spout and ergonomic handle further enhance the user experience, making pouring effortless. Conversely, the Tea Kettle by Tohsssik features a spout lid design that prevents water from spraying out, ensuring safety during use. It also boasts a loud whistle that alerts users when water reaches boiling point, a feature that is particularly useful in busy households.
Capacity and Size
Both products have their specific capacities tailored to different needs. The Glass Teapot holds 800ml (27oz), making it ideal for personal use or small gatherings. This capacity is perfect for brewing a few cups of tea, allowing for a cozy experience. In contrast, the Tea Kettle has a larger capacity of 2 liters, making it suitable for boiling larger quantities of water quickly. This difference in capacity highlights the teapot's focus on brewing and enjoyment versus the kettle's emphasis on efficiency and volume.
Cleaning and Maintenance
When it comes to cleaning, the Glass Teapot is dishwasher safe, which adds to its convenience for everyday use. Additionally, its glass material does not retain odors or stains, ensuring a clean taste with every brew. The Tea Kettle, while also easy to clean due to its stainless steel construction, requires a bit more effort to maintain its shine. It can be cleaned using acetic acid or lemon, but it may require regular upkeep to prevent tarnishing over time.
